Norwegian Bokmål

Etymology 1

From Danish vej.

Alternative forms

  • veg

Noun

vei m (definite singular veien, indefinite plural veier, definite plural veiene)

  1. road; way; street; path
    bane vei - pave the way

Romanian

Pronunciation

  • IPA(key): [vej]

Verb

(tu) vei (modal auxiliary, second-person singular form of vrea, used with infinitives to form future indicative tenses)

  1. (you) will
    dacă mă duc acuma vei veni cu mine?
    if I leave now, will you come with me?
